Responsibilities

Overview/ Responsibilities:

The successful candidate will lead and manage a large program, be responsible for successful program execution and attainment of all contractual performance requirements, customer satisfaction, and achievement of all cost, schedule, and quality objectives. The candidate is responsible for meeting revenue and margin objectives as established by Sector guidance, and development of growth strategies to meet desired growth objectives. He/she must be highly collaborative, working across organizational boundaries to assist other business and functional leaders where possible.

Specific Responsibilities Include

  • Lead and manage project development from inception to deployment, with expertise in network sustainment.
  • Direct all phases of projects from inception to completion.
  • Responsible for Cost, Schedule, and technical performance of multiple projects or major tasks.
  • Act independently to uncover and/or resolve issues associated with the development and implementation of operational programs.
  • Demonstrated capability to manage multiple network projects.
  • Ability to drive performance in a team environment with responsibilities to assist in the development of new technologies to address existing network challenges.
  • Participate in negotiation of contract and contract changes.
  • Act as a primary customer contact for program activities, leading program review sessions with the customer to discuss cost, schedule, and technical performance.
  • Applies extensive expertise in the management and leverage of security tools, security incident handling, and incident remediation.
  • Develops new business and/or expands existing task orders.
  • Establishes milestones and monitors adherence to plans and schedules, identifies project problems and obtains solutions, such as allocation of resources or change contractual specifications.
  • Directs the work of employees assigned to the project(s) from technical, management and administrative areas.
  • He/she will collaborate with functional and line of business leaders to ensure all contractual requirements are met, resulting in quality deliverables, high levels of customer satisfaction, and excellent CPAR evaluations of our work.

Qualifications

Required Qualifications:

The successful candidate will have experience, knowledge, skills, and abilities as outlined:

  • BS 10-12, MS 8-10, PhD 5-7
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ain an active U.S. Top Secret/SCI Security Clearance.
  • Must possess the required DoD 8140 certification (e.g., CompTIA Security ).
  • At least 10 years of progressively responsible leadership with P&L Leadership experience for a portfolio of programs valued up to $20M in annual sales.
  • Experienced in delivering complex program objectives to include network sustainment.
  • Excellent business acumen; strong understanding of federal procurement, contracting, and financial rules and regulations.
  • Ability to develop and maintain a robust pipeline of qualified opportunities within targeted DoW accounts, and a strong understanding of the technological trends, needs, and buying habits of the customer.
  • Ability to forecast client needs and propose solutions that meet their needs while profitably growing our business.
  • Possess superior people skills and ability to build a positive work culture and environment, and interact effectively with employees and all levels of management.

Desired Qualifications

  • Willingness to travel both domestically and internationally, as needed
  • PMP certification
  • Proven ability to partner with growth professionals to build constructive relationships with key customers, and shape and capture business opportunities
